Bobby F
VerifiedJuly 12, 2025 • Stayed at: 09, Loop: Standard NonElectric
Camp sites are a little close for some, so I can see where it could get crowded during high traffic periods. Otherwise, it was great. Great fishing, the lake is right there, very little light pollution, so the stars at night are phenomenal. We saw a heard of deer come down to the lake for a drink while were there. The restrooms are well maintained and very clean, no orders. We hiked Bullion Canyon and saw the falls, which is about an hour drive from the lake, but worth it. Overall, fantastic experience.

Policies & Rules
General
- BEARS: Bears frequent this area; please keep all food, garbage and scented items locked up and inaccessible to wildlife.
- Street legal and non-street legal vehicles are allowed for access and egress only.
- Horses are not allowed in the campground.
- There are no electricity, water or sewer site hookups at the campground.
- This is a 'pack it in-pack it out' facility. No garbage services are available. Please bring you own garbage bags.
- Camping is limited to 16 days.
- Any vehicles or trailers that can not fit in the designated site must be relocated to another site purchased at full site price. Check area map for available free parking.

- Don't Move Firewood: Help prevent the spread of tree-killing pests in our national forests by obtaining firewood near your destination and burning it on-site. For more information visit dontmovefirewood.org.
- Discharging a firearm of any kind is prohibited: this includes BB guns, slingshots, paintball guns etc. Take these activities outside of the campground please.
